Good Chop at a Glance

Before jumping into the nitty-gritty details, let’s start with a high-level overview.

Key Facts About Good Chop:

  • Launched in 2019 specializing in meat & sustainable seafood delivery
  • Ship customized boxes every 2, 4, 6 or 8 weeks
  • Offer beef, poultry, pork & seafood all sourced from U.S. producers
  • Humanely raised meats without antibiotics or added hormones
  • 100% satisfaction guarantee + flexible subscriptions

Comparing Good Chop’s Pricing to the Competition

I also wanted to scrutinize how Good Chop’s costs stack up against competitors. Using my extensive market pricing knowledge, I conducted an in-depth price comparison.

Here’s a pricing breakdown of Good Chop versus leading industry competitors on a per pound/item basis:

Company Steaks Per Lb Ground Beef Per Lb Pork Chops Per Lb Salmon Per 6 oz
Good Chop $16 $9 $15 $8
Butcher Box $17 $10 $18 $12
Crowd Cow $19 $11 $16 $10

Analyzing this pricing matrix shows Good Chop coming in at highly affordable rates across the board from steaks to seafood. They beat competitors substantially in some categories like Salmon where CrowdCow charges nearly $4 more per pound.

The Pricing Verdict: Outstanding value for 100% grass-fed beef & sustainable wild seafood shipped directly to your door.

Evaluating Additional Good Chop Service & Support

In addition to order quality and affordability, I also rigorously evaluated supplementary aspects of their service including:

Customer Service

  • ★★★★1⁄2
  • Phone hold time under 60 seconds
  • Friendly and resolved missing item issue
  • Compensated fully for replacement

Delivery & Shipping

  • ★★★★☆
  • 7 days from order to doorstep
  • Well-insulated with sufficient ice packs
  • Prefer more delivery precision

Subscription Flexibility

  • ★★★★★
  • Pause, skip or cancel anytime
  • Reactivate without losing preferred pricing
  • Month-to-month without penalties

Website Experience

  • ★★★★☆
  • Easy onboarding process
  • Intuitive design and product customization
  • Minor lag when applying discounts
